Former Lioness Alex Scott has revealed the reason why she chose to detail her past relationship with her teammate Kelly Smith in her new memoir. 

The footballer, 37, who played alongside Kelly, 43, for both England and Arsenal, confirmed their once rumoured relationship for the first time earlier this week. 

Speaking on The One Show on Wednesday, Alex explained that ‘parts of the relationship affected her throughout her life’ and she needed to ‘break the cycle.’

Joining Alex Jones and Jermaine Jenas she explained: ‘I am super private and I will continue to be about my relationships.

‘The only reason why I wrote that chapter because I was doing this book and felt like I was cheating, not only myself but everyone else, if I didn’t include it.’

‘It was such a big part of my life, it’s about me falling deeply in love, that feeling we all wish we would have and I was lucky to have that.’

She added: ‘There are parts of that relationship that have continued, part of that I have carried into other things, that I needed to change. I needed to break the cycle.

‘There was certain parts of that relationship that affected me throughout my life.’

It comes as the footballer candidly admitted that Kelly was her ‘first love’ as she spoke of the ‘heartbreak’ that followed when they split. 

In the book, titled How (Not) To Be Strong, Alex lifts the lid on her past and added that it would be ‘cheating’ to not include their time together as they helped each other face their demons.

Sources close to Alex also revealed that she has had relationships with both men and women but ‘doesn’t label herself as anything.’ 

Speaking to The Mirror at the launch, she explained: ‘I’m writing this book and I want to tell everything. I thought I’d be cheating you all if I didn’t put that in there. 

‘For me, it’s like that first love story, I fell madly and deeply in love. And yes, there’s that heartbreak and those things, but it’s a huge part of my life and I wouldn’t go back and change that.

‘Because that feeling of love and that excitement and what it gives you, it needed to be in there.’
